Food illness in Jimbaran Bali is a concern that can affect travelers, especially those eager to explore local cuisine. While many dining experiences are safe and enjoyable, differences in food handling, ingredients, and preparation styles can sometimes lead to digestive issues.

Understanding how food illness develops and recognizing early symptoms can help travelers respond quickly and avoid more serious complications.

Why Food Illness Can Occur in Jimbaran

Food illness during travel is often related to changes in diet and exposure to unfamiliar bacteria. Even well-prepared meals can affect digestion if the body is not used to certain ingredients.

Travelers who have experienced nausea after eating in Jimbaran or stomach discomfort in Jimbaran Bali may already notice how sensitive the digestive system can be during travel.

Common Symptoms of Food Illness

Symptoms Travelers May Experience

  • nausea after eating
  • vomiting
  • diarrhea
  • stomach discomfort

These symptoms can vary in intensity, depending on how the body reacts to the food consumed.

How Food Illness Can Affect the Body

Food illness can disrupt the digestive system and affect overall energy levels. Fluid loss from vomiting or diarrhea can quickly lead to weakness and discomfort.

This is often connected to dehydration in Jimbaran Bali, which can develop if the body loses fluids faster than they are replaced.

When Food Illness Becomes More Serious

When Food Illness Becomes More Serious
When Food Illness Becomes More Serious

Warning Signs That Require Attention

  • persistent vomiting or diarrhea
  • inability to stay hydrated
  • fever
  • worsening weakness

Is food illness common in Jimbaran Bali?

Food illness can happen to travelers, especially when trying new or unfamiliar foods. However, most cases are mild and manageable with proper care.

What causes food poisoning during travel?

It is usually caused by bacteria, contaminated food, or differences in food preparation. Changes in the digestive system during travel can also play a role.

Can seafood in Jimbaran lead to food illness?

Seafood is generally safe, but improper handling or sensitivity to certain ingredients can trigger symptoms. It is important to choose reputable dining places.

How long do symptoms usually last?

Mild symptoms often improve within a short time with rest and hydration. However, more severe cases may last longer and require medical attention.

Can dehydration result from food illness?

Yes, dehydration can occur quickly due to fluid loss from vomiting or diarrhea. This is why maintaining hydration is essential during illness.

When should I be concerned about symptoms?

You should be concerned if symptoms persist, worsen, or prevent you from staying hydrated. Early medical care can help prevent complications.

Should I avoid eating after getting sick?

It is better to switch to light and easily digestible foods rather than stop eating completely. Proper nutrition supports recovery.

Is it safe to stay in my hotel while recovering?

Yes, resting in your accommodation is often recommended for mild cases. However, you should monitor your condition closely.
